SALEM TWP. — State Police are asking the public for help finding a missing woman they say is endangered, even as they and firefighters searched the Susquehanna Riverlands trails and the nearby river for her.

Linda Carmella Shaw, 63, of Cope Road, Shickshinny, has been missing since 11:30 a.m. Monday, said Tpr. Jeffrey Miller in a report released late Monday night. 

Shaw, originally from Huntington Township, was last seen near the Susquehanna River here, troopers said.

She was wearing blue jeans, a long gray hooded sweatshirt, and light-colored sneakers.

Shaw is 5 feet, 3 inches tall, weighs 130 pounds, and has black hair and brown eyes, State Police said.

Miller asked anyone who has information about what happened to her or where she is to call the Shickshinny barracks at 570-542-4117.

Salem Township Police confirmed Shaw is the missing person that rescuers were trying to find at the popular park Monday night and Tuesday.
